Abstract
The invention discloses one kind is fire-retardant exempting to paint solid wood board, including base material, fire prevention dipping paper, metal wire-drawing net and panel, panel is located at the opposite sides of base material, the both sides of base material are equipped with fire prevention dipping paper and metal wire-drawing net, fire prevention dipping paper and metal wire-drawing net laying are located between base material and panel, and metal wire-drawing net is located between panel and fire prevention dipping paper.Due to being equipped with fire prevention dipping paper and metal wire-drawing net between base material and panel, therefore so that the fire-retardant paint solid wood board of exempting from has good flame retardant effect, reduces potential safety hazard when using;Meanwhile, fire prevention dipping paper can be fixed by metal wire-drawing net, simultaneously work as styling, it is ensured that fire prevention dipping paper can be laid on base material, and can effectively prevent base material from ftractureing in use.

Specific embodiment
The present invention is further detailed explanation below in conjunction with the accompanying drawings.
As shown in figure 1, fire-retardant exempt to paint solid wood board, including base material 1, fire prevention dipping paper 2, metal wire-drawing net 3 and panel 4,
Panel 4 is equipped with fire prevention dipping paper 2 and metal wire-drawing net 3, fire prevention dipping paper located at the opposite sides of base material 1, the both sides of base material 1
2 and metal wire-drawing net 3 be layed between base material 1 and panel 4, metal wire-drawing net 3 be located at panel 4 with fire prevention impregnate paper 2 between.Its
In, the edge flush of base material 1, fire prevention dipping paper 2, metal wire-drawing net 3 and panel 4;The sizing grid of metal wire-drawing net 3 is 1
~2mm, the net bar external diameter of metal wire-drawing net 3 is 0.3~1mm, so that metal wire-drawing net 3 forms closely knit grid, has
Good fire resistance.In actual use, metal wire-drawing net 3 can be aluminum wire drawing net or copper wire drawing net or many
Metal material mixing composition is planted, different use demands can be met.
Panel 4 is fire prevention anion woodgrained paper, so that panel 4 can be closely bonded with metal wire-drawing net 3, realizes resistance
Combustion exempts to paint the water-proof function of solid wood board.
When fire prevention dipping paper 2 is produced, decorative paper is immersed in weight ratio is:88% melamine resin adehsive, 7%
Fire retardant, 2% dispersant, 2% suspending agent and 1% defoamer mixed liquor in, take out and dry to 2~4 one-tenth dry (i.e. tables
Face dries).The fire prevention dipping paper 2 for obtaining is with good fire protecting performance, and adhesive property is good.
During production, the preparation method of anion woodgrained paper of preventing fires comprises the steps:
A, dipping woodgrained paper body paper is immersed in weight ratio it is:91% melamine resin adehsive, 4% fire retardant, 2%
Dispersant, 2% suspending agent and 1% defoamer mixed liquor in;
B, above-mentioned dipping paper is continuously exported after dry to 1~3 one-tenth and do after (i.e. dry tack free);
C, the dipping woodgrained paper single face obtained through step B coat the resistance to grinding fluid of fire prevention anion, and wherein, fire prevention anion is resistance to
The weight ratio of grinding fluid is:70% melamine glue, 8% negative ion powder, 4% titania powder, 7% alundum (Al2O3)
Powder, 5% fire retardant, 3% dispersant, 1% suspending agent and 2% defoamer;
After D, the resistance to grinding fluid of fire prevention anion are covered with paint, lacquer, colour wash, etc. uniformly, the fire prevention anion woodgrained paper for obtaining is dried to 2~5 layers
Dry.Can cause overall fire protecting performance to improve by fire prevention anion woodgrained paper being laid in the outside of base material 1, and aoxidize by three
Two aluminium powders improve anti-wear performance, play a part of purify air by negative ion powder.
The fire-retardant paint solid wood board of exempting from lays fire prevention dipping paper 2, metal wire-drawing in laying successively in the side of base material 1
Net 3 and the fire prevention anion woodgrained paper of panel 4;Being put into hot press after the completion of laying carries out HTHP pressing thermosetting process.In the same manner,
After solidification, the opposite side of base material 1 is carried out same treatment, finally give and complete fire-retardant exempt to paint solid wood board.
Thus, the fire-retardant of the present invention exempts to paint solid wood board under the collective effect of metal wire-drawing net 3 and fire prevention dipping paper 2,
Radiating, fire retardation well can be played;While playing styling by metal wire-drawing net 3 to sheet material, effectively prevent
Sheet material cracking phenomena, can be widely applied to the fields such as floor, metope and furniture.
